Description
Avon Cottage is a small timber-framed cottage dating from the 17th century, featuring brick infill panels. It has a steeply pitched plain tile roof with gabled ends and is set on sandstone foundations. There is a later outshut added to the north elevation. The cottage has small casement windows with glazing bars and plank doors, along with a single brick chimney stack at the ridge.
